We walk through bone and cartilage 101 with Dr. Gray Stallman, from Wolff’s law to why hips and spines fail, and how smart stress restores strength. Practical tools, from strength training to DEXA scans and nutrition, show how to slow loss, manage arthritis, and regain function. • bone as living tissue that adapts to force • articular vs fibrocartilage and healing limits • osteoporosis risks, menopause, and fracture impact • DEXA timing, spine changes, and posture decline • use it or lose it...
